<h3 id="comprehending-relocation-quotes-and-estimates" id="comprehending-relocation-quotes-and-estimates">Comprehending Relocation Quotes and Estimates</h3>

<p>When looking for a regional moving service, comprehending moving quotes is crucial. Companies often provide a couple of estimates: binding and non-binding. A fixed estimate ensures the overall price agreed upon in advance, while a non-binding estimate is an approximation that can vary based on the ultimate weight of your items and extra services needed. It&#39;s important to discuss which type of estimate a company offers and ensure you are clear about any potential variations that could arise.</p>

<p>To get a fair estimate, you should collect quotes from various moving companies. This comparison not only allows you to see the typical costs but also helps you spot outliers that may suggest either very low service quality or unseen fees. Be sure to ask each company what their estimate covers, such as labor, shipping, packing materials, and any additional services. Understanding these elements will assist you evaluate the actual value of each quote you get.</p>

<p>Lastly, be watchful for any red flags in the estimating procedure. A reputable mover will prefer to conduct an on-site walk-through of your home to provide an exact estimate, while a service that offers quotes over the telephone without evaluating your belongings may not have your best interests in consideration. Ensuring that you understand the specifics of your estimate and the services it covers will help you avoid unexpected costs and ensure your moving journey more efficient and smooth.</p>
